Date(s) Skied: March 13, 2011
Resort or Ski Area: Saddleback
Conditions: A bit of everything
Trip Report: Surprisingly good day at Saddleback. We decided to sleep in due to time change and make a half-day of it. Skied 12:30 to close and it was pretty good.
Saddleback has a lot of cover. Deepest of the season. The liquid event locked it all up however. The natural trails off the rangeley softened up a bit. Peachy's and Smelt skied pretty well considering. Definitely firm, but enough loose stuff to make it fun.
Groomers of the day were the Devils and Silver Doctor. Sugary snow mostly. Tight line skied pretty well from the top... while Supervisor was pretty chunky.
We need 1 more dump followed by no rain then bring on the spring skiing! Saddleback is all primed for a good spring.
Their website blog says they are going to stay open on weekends through May. Very cool.
